Belongs to a group of small to medium-sized lepidopterans within the brush-footed butterfly family Nymphalinae, distinguished by a contrasting and intricate wing pattern. Adults of Phystis simois typically possess a wingspan measuring between 32 and 38 millimeters. The dorsal surface of the wings features a deep dark brown to black ground color, heavily adorned with a series of transverse bands and spots in shades of bright orange, yellow, and cream, forming a characteristic checkered design. Conversely, the ventral side is significantly paler and highly cryptic, exhibiting a complex mosaic of light brown, grayish-brown, and pearly-white patches, which provides remarkable camouflage when the insect rests vertically with its wings folded. The antennae are slender, featuring distinct, pale-tipped apical clubs.
Geographical distribution: This species is widely distributed across the temperate and tropical regions of South America. Its geographic range spans extensively through central and southern Brazil, particularly within the Atlantic Forest and Cerrado biomes. Furthermore, its populations extend southwards into northern and central Argentina, throughout Paraguay, and across several departments of Uruguay, utilizing major river basins as crucial ecological corridors for genetic dispersal.
Habitat: It primarily inhabits transitional zones and open or semi-open ecosystems. The species is frequently observed along humid forest edges, secondary forest clearings, scrublands, grasslands, shrubby savannas, and disturbed environments such as urban gardens, old fields, and rural roadsides. It displays high ecological plasticity, thriving in human-modified landscapes provided its larval host plants and adequate microhabitats are present.
Feeding: As a caterpillar, this insect is a specialist herbivore that feeds on the foliage of plants in the family Acanthaceae, with a strong preference for the genera Justicia, Ruellia, and Dicliptera. Adult butterflies sustain themselves by consuming the nectar of wildflowers, showing a preference for families such as Asteraceae and Verbenaceae. Additionally, males are commonly seen gathering on damp soil, mud, or wet sand along riverbanks to extract water, mineral salts, and sodium, an essential physiological behavior known as mud-puddling.
Behavior: It exhibits strictly diurnal activity, with peak flight times occurring during warm, sunny hours. Its flight is characterized as low, erratic, and fluttering, usually remaining within one meter of the ground or grassy vegetation. Males exhibit prominent territorial behavior, establishing perches on sunlit leaves to patrol their territories, chase off rivals, and intercept passing females. To regulate body temperature, they frequently bask with their wings spread wide to absorb solar radiation.
Reproduction: The life cycle begins after mating, when the female searches for suitable host plants belonging to the family Acanthaceae to lay her eggs. She deposits small clusters of pale yellow or greenish eggs on the underside of young leaves, protecting them from desiccation and predators. Upon hatching, the larvae go through several instars; early-instar caterpillars are gregarious, feeding together under loose silk webs, whereas older caterpillars become solitary. The mature larvae are dark-colored with branched spines or scoli along their bodies. Pupation occurs within a pendant chrysalis attached upside down to a twig or stem by a cremaster, resembling a dry leaf to avoid predation.
Conservation status: Currently, this taxon has not been globally evaluated by the International Union for Conservation of Nature (IUCN), and therefore lacks an official classification on the Red List. However, at regional levels, it is generally considered of Least Concern due to its expansive range, tolerance to human-modified habitats, and the abundance of its larval host plants. Local populations face localized threats from pesticide runoff and habitat fragmentation due to urban and agricultural expansion.
